Ingredients

serves 4
  • 1 shallot
  • 3 tablespoons fresh ginger
  • 1 clove garlic
  • ¼ cup white miso paste
  • 2 tablespoons rice wine vinegar
  • ½ teaspoon sesame oil
  • ⅓ cup oil
  • 2 tablespoons honey or agave
  • Cooked rice ((or other grain of choice--quinoa, couscous, or farro would all work great))
  • A couple handfuls of bok choy or any leafy vegetable of choice
  • 1 pound steak ((ribeye, sirloin, and skirt steak all work well; cut into 1.5 inch cubes))
  • 2 tablespoons butter or oil
  • 1 teaspoon dark soy sauce
  • Salt to taste
